VPNs and the Law: An International View
The legality of VPNs varies significantly across the globe. In some countries, like the United States, VPN use is recognized and popular. However, in others, such as China and Russia, VPNs are subject to strict regulations due to political motivations. It's important for users to be cognizant of the specific regulations governing VPN use in their area. Failure to comply with local laws can result in severe penalties.
